Lodhi Gardens, a sprawling 90-acre park in the heart of Delhi, offers a serene escape from the city's hustle and bustle. 

It's a captivating blend of history and nature, housing exquisite architectural marvels that date back to the 15th century.

The park is renowned for its iconic tombs, including those of Mohammed Shah and Sikander Lodi, which are prime examples of Indo-Islamic architecture.

These magnificent structures, adorned with intricate carvings and domes, stand as silent witnesses to Delhi's glorious past.

Beyond its historical significance, Lodhi Gardens is a paradise for nature enthusiasts.

Expansive lawns, vibrant flower beds, and towering trees create a picturesque setting for leisurely walks, picnics, and photography.

The garden's tranquil ambiance and lush greenery make it a popular spot for yoga, meditation, and simply unwinding.
